Iroquois Falls Main Roadway Gets A Needed Facelift

There is a new road running through the centre of Iroquois Falls that may look rather familiar.

The oldest street in Iroquois Falls which runs through the heart of the town, Ambridge Drive, has finally finished its long awaited reconstruction as of this week.

Mayor Michael Shea says the reconstruction of one of their main roadways will allow people to enjoy their walk and drive through the centre of town.

He also says the reconstruction of the road was long overdue, and he is very happy the local population will now have an easier time accessing stores along Ambridge Drive.

Shea also says the multimillion dollar investment in infrastructure will be the first of many more to come to the area over the next few years.
